How do hoarding cleanup services approach extreme cases?
In extreme hoarding cases, professional cleanup services follow a systematic approach to ensure safety and efficiency. The process starts with an assessment of the home’s condition, identifying hazards such as mold, pests, or biohazards. The team then develops a customized cleanup plan, working closely with the client to sort and declutter items. They also address sanitation issues by deep cleaning and disinfecting affected areas. Extreme cases may require collaboration with mental health professionals, pest control services, or structural repair specialists. The goal is to restore a safe, livable environment while providing support to prevent relapse.

How does fentanyl contamination affect landlords?
Landlords face significant challenges when dealing with fentanyl-contaminated properties. Failing to address contamination can lead to legal liability, while cleanup costs may strain financial resources. Contamination issues can also deter prospective tenants, resulting in lost rental income. Professional decontamination services provide landlords with a reliable solution, ensuring the property meets safety standards and is ready for occupancy.

How does air quality testing enhance energy efficiency?
Air quality testing can indirectly improve energy efficiency by identifying issues related to ventilation and airflow. Poor air circulation often forces HVAC systems to work harder, consuming more energy and increasing operational costs. Testing highlights problem areas such as clogged filters, poorly designed ducts, or inadequate insulation, which can be optimized to improve airflow and efficiency. By ensuring that air purifiers and ventilation systems operate effectively, testing reduces energy waste while maintaining optimal air quality. Improved energy efficiency benefits both residential and commercial properties, leading to lower utility bills and a reduced environmental footprint.
What are the signs of a rodent infestation?
Signs include droppings, gnaw marks, nesting materials, unusual odors, and scratching noises. Prompt action is essential to prevent further contamination and damage.
